Essential Packing Advice for Your Long-Distance Relocation
Proper preparation is vital for a successful long-distance relocation, as it guarantees that possessions get there safely and intact. To start, people should collect quality packing materials, such as durable containers, protective padding, and adhesive tape. Sorting belongings by location can streamline the process and reduce the risk of misplacing items. It is recommended to mark each box clearly, indicating both the contents and the intended room, which facilitates unloading.
Fragile objects need careful attention; wrapping them individually in bubble wrap or packing paper can assist in preventing breakage. Additionally, filling empty gaps inside boxes with packing peanuts or crumpled related information paper adds extra cushioning. For heavier objects, using smaller boxes prevents strain and ensures safe handling. Finally, packing an essentials box with necessary items for the first few days can make settling in much smoother. By following these packing tips, people can increase the efficiency and safety of their long-distance move.

Cost Management Tips for a Long-Distance Move
Budgeting for a cross-country transfer calls for careful organization and anticipation. First, people should prepare a exhaustive record of their items to estimate the amount and mass of items being shipped. This can help in procuring accurate quotations from relocation services. It is suggested to construct a achievable budget that includes not only moving costs but also ancillary expenses such as boxing supplies, temporary quarters, and travel costs to the new location.
Next, people should think about the timing of the move. Rates may differ significantly based on the season or day of the week. Booking well in advance can often lead to improved rates. Furthermore, it is beneficial to research and compare several relocation services to find the greatest savings. In conclusion, setting aside a emergency reserve for unexpected expenses will offer a financial buffer, ensuring a easier transition throughout this significant transition.

Frequently Asked Questions
When ought I book My relocation service in ahead?
Specialists advise booking a relocation company at least four to six weeks in advance. This timeframe allows better availability, possible financial advantages, and sufficient planning, ultimately ensuring a easier relocation experience for the person.
Which Products Are Not Allowed During Long-Distance Relocation Services?
Dangerous substances, perishable foods, plants, and valuable items including funds or gems are usually prohibited during cross-country relocations. To ensure adherence to regulations and safety standards, movers customarily provide a detailed list.
Do relocation services offer packing materials, or should I obtain my own?
Moving companies usually offer packing supplies as part of their services, but it's advisable to confirm beforehand. Some people prefer to purchase their own materials for added control over quality and quantity during the moving process.
Can I track My Belongings During the Move?
Most moving companies provide tracking services for belongings during a relocation. Customers can typically oversee their shipment's status via an online portal or by contacting the company, ensuring peace of mind throughout the transition.
What Occurs if My Items Get Damaged During Transport?
If possessions are harmed during transit, the moving company typically examines the complaint. Depending on the insurance coverage, compensation may be offered. Proper documentation and timely notification enhance the likelihood of a positive resolution.
